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Offaly School.

11.

asked the Minister for Finance the present position in regard to Shinrone, County Offaly, national school; whether he proposes to build a five-teacher school; if so, when tenders will be advertised and when building is likely to commence; and whether he intends to provide a study room and work room at the school.

A grant has been sanctioned by the Department of Education for the provision of a new school at Shinrone consisting of five classrooms and a general purposes room. The preparation of plans, specification and bills of quantities will be put in hands as early as possible and subject to the clearance of title to part of the site it is hoped to invite tenders before the end of the present financial year.
